OMGHotels.com
1nt: 4* London stay, breakfast & Buckingham Palace: £258 for two
1nt: 4* London stay, breakfast & Buckingham Palace: £258 for two
Regular price
£258.00 GBP
Regular price
Sale price
£258.00 GBP
Unit price
/
per